原文:SpringCloud Feign異常處理

概述 網絡請求時,可能會出現以下異常請求,如果想在發生異常的情況下使系統可用,就要進行容錯處理。發生異常的情況可能有網絡請求超時 url參數錯誤等等。 Spring Cloud Feign就是通過Fallback實現的,有以下兩種方式: FeignClient.fallback UserFeignFallback.class 指定一個實現Feign接口的類,當出現異常時調用該類中相應的方法 Fei ...

2019-03-12 11:32 0 555 推薦指數:

查看詳情

Feign調用全局異常處理解決

fallback方法,就會拋出上述異常。由此引出了第一個解決方式。 解決方案: 自定義Feign解析 ...

Wed Dec 01 23:02:00 CST 2021 0 349
23.SpringCloud實戰項目-整合統一異常處理

簡介 PassJava-Learning項目是PassJava(佳必過)項目的學習教程。對架構、業務、技術要點進行講解。 PassJava 是一款Java面試刷題的開源系統,可以用零碎時間 ...

Wed May 27 18:49:00 CST 2020 0 844
SpringCloud-技術專區-Gateway全局通用異常處理

為什么需要全局異常處理 在傳統 Spring Boot 應用中, 我們 @ControllerAdvice 來處理全局的異常,進行統一包裝返回 // 摘至 spring cloud alibaba console 模塊處理 ...

Fri Jul 03 01:01:00 CST 2020 0 896
SpringCloud學習之Zuul統一異常處理及回退

一、Filter中統一異常處理   其實在SpringCloud的Edgware SR2版本中對於ZuulFilter中的錯誤有統一的處理,但是在實際開發當中對於錯誤的響應方式,我想每個團隊都有自己的處理規范。那么如何做到自定義的異常處理呢? 我們可以先參考一下SpringCloud提供 ...

Tue Apr 17 05:57:00 CST 2018 2 5564
異常處理和全局異常處理

在我們正常的增刪改查業務中 ,如果發生系統異常,則直接會給用戶拋出不友好的異常信息。為了增加用戶的體驗,應該給一些適當信息進行提示。例如刪除頻道的代碼,如下 紅框圈起來的是可以給用戶友好提示的,但是當執行刪除這一行代碼,如果失敗了有可能系統會拋出異常。那這個時候就不應該把異常信息直接 ...

Sat Mar 06 19:04:00 CST 2021 0 284
Spring Cloud Feign+Hystrix自定義異常處理

開啟Hystrix spring-cloud-dependencies Dalston版本之后,默認Feign對Hystrix的支持默認是關閉的,需要手動開啟。 開啟hystrix,可以選擇關閉熔斷或超時。 關閉熔斷: 設置超時: 關閉超時: Fallback ...

Sun Dec 08 10:27:00 CST 2019 0 1023
python之異常處理

先來看一段代碼: 運行的時候money輸入10,month輸入0,查看結果: 運行的時候money輸入aa,month輸入hhh,查看結果:hhh 在運行過程中我們需要對異常進行處理,讓代碼能繼續執行之后的部分,修改代碼: 運行的,money輸入10,month輸入 ...

Wed Feb 28 04:58:00 CST 2018 0 1252
HttpClient異常處理

HTTP傳輸安全 自動異常恢復 自定義異常處理 一、傳輸異常 傳輸異常都是諸如不 ...

Fri Jan 17 19:09:00 CST 2020 0 2337
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M